I have a function that should have three required
and in best case named
parameters. The last one (" finished
") should be optional
. I tried it like this:
static void showOverlay(BuildContext context, String text, bool successfull,
[VoidCallback? finished]) {}
but Flutter is complaining:
Avoid positional boolean parameters
The weird thing is that it is only complaining about the bool successfull
. What am I doing wrong here and how can I fix this?

Named parameters are optional unless they're specifically marked as required . Below, all four of your parameters are named. Three are required
while one of them is optional.
static void showOverlay({required BuildContext context, required String text,
required bool successfull, VoidCallback? finished}) {}

Positional boolean parameters are a bad practice because they are very ambiguous. Using named boolean parameters is much more readable because it inherently describes what the boolean value represents.
BAD:
Task(true);
Task(false);
ListBox(false, true, true);
Button(false);
GOOD:
Task.oneShot();
Task.repeating();
ListBox(scroll: true, showScrollbars: true);
Button(ButtonState.enabled);
